Turtle Mountain Band of Chippewa Indians Tribal Code.

26.20.180 Penalty for Mutilating or Destroying Forestry, Fire Prevention, Fire Danger, Fire Control Signs; Destruction of Gates

(a) Whoever intentionally breaks down, defaces, mutilates, removes, or destroys any forestry, fire prevention, fire danger or fire control sign commits a Class 2 offense. Such person shall also be held financially responsible for replacement costs.

(b) Whoever intentionally and without authority breaks down, mutilates, removes or destroys any gate(s) erected to control access to or upon any fire trail, fire access road, or designated park and recreation trail or road shall be found guilty of a Class 2 offense. Such person shall also be held financially responsible for replacement and installation costs.
